Summary

Prevents large numeric IDs (e.g., 64-bit integers) from losing precision when parsed from URL search parameters. Previously, all search values were passed through JSON.parse, which coerces large numbers to JavaScript's Number type and silently truncates them. This fix ensures only structured JSON values (objects and arrays) are parsed, while plain strings and numbers are left as-is.

Changes

  • Introduced a safeJsonParse function that only calls JSON.parse on values beginning with { or [, leaving all other values as raw strings to avoid numeric precision loss.
  • Configured the router to use parseSearchWith(safeJsonParse) instead of the default search parser.

Confidence Score: 4/5

Safe to merge the UI change; the Go matview fix needs a mechanism to rebuild the existing view on upgrade.

The ui/app/main.tsx change is low-risk and self-contained. The mv_filter_users DDL change is the right fix logically, but CREATE MATERIALIZED VIEW IF NOT EXISTS means the updated COALESCE expression is never applied to an already-existing view — existing users won't see the behaviour change until the view is rebuilt manually or a drop mechanism is added.

framework/logstore/matviews.go — the selectExpr change needs a way to force-rebuild the existing mv_filter_users view on upgrade.

## ✨ Features

- **Azure v1 API Migration** — Migrated Azure provider to the v1 API:
removed the `api-version` query parameter and the
`/openai/deployments/{model}/...` URL pattern in favor of
`/openai/v1/{operation}`; the `api_version` field has been dropped from
`AzureKeyConfig` (#3661, #3756)
- **EnvVar Support for OTEL & Prometheus Configs** — `CollectorURL`,
`MetricsEndpoint`, headers, push gateway URL, and basic auth credentials
can now be sourced from environment variables (e.g.,
`env.OTEL_COLLECTOR_URL`); added a new `ConfigMarshallerPlugin`
interface that lets plugins control storage/redaction round-trips
(#3651)
- **OTel Extra Header Forwarding** — `x-bf-eh-*` extra headers forwarded
to upstream providers are now also emitted on the request span under
`gen_ai.request.extra_header.*` for end-to-end tracing (#3730)
- **OTel Semantic Conventions** — Aligned OTel attribute keys with the
OpenTelemetry GenAI spec (canonical `gen_ai.*` and new `bifrost.*`
attributes); legacy attributes are retained in parallel to avoid
breaking existing dashboards (#3732)
- **VK Quota with Provider Configs** — `GetVirtualKeyQuotaByValue` and
the `getVirtualKeyQuota` HTTP response now include `provider_configs`
with their budgets and rate limits (#3721)
- **MCP Temp Token Non-Auth Toggle** — Added
`mcp_enable_temp_token_auth` client config flag to gate short-lived MCP
token minting for non-authenticated users (#3720)
- **Responses Stream in JSON Parser** — `jsonparser` plugin now handles
OpenAI Responses API streaming (`ResponsesStreamRequest`) in addition to
chat completions (#3749)
- **Session API Rework** — Logout now calls both the password-based
session logout and OAuth logout endpoints and resets all RTK Query cache
state (#3698)

## 🐞 Fixed

- **Streaming Latency for Observability** — Deferred root span
termination to the trace completer callback for streaming requests so
request latency is no longer inflated by header-flush time (#3762)
- **Stream Cancellation Race** — Set `BifrostContextKeyConnectionClosed`
before closing the stream and short-circuit `idleTimeoutReader.Read`
when the connection is already closed to avoid panics and hangs on
cancellation (#3733)
- **Bedrock Cache Points** — Strip cache points from Bedrock requests
for models that do not support prompt caching (e.g., GLM, Llama) to
avoid Converse API errors (#3754)
- **Bedrock Empty Text Blocks** — Skip empty/nil text blocks during
Bedrock response conversion to avoid invalid messages (#3747)
- **Bedrock Reasoning + Tools** — Preserve reasoning content blocks on
assistant turns that also contain tool calls in the Bedrock chat
converter (#3690)
- **Bedrock Search Content & Video** — Restored search content and video
parts that were being dropped from Bedrock-native passthrough requests
(#3729)
- **Structured Output Stop Reason** — Fixed an incorrect `tool_calls`
finish reason when structured output is combined with extended-thinking
tools (#3685)
- **Gemini Tool Schema Passthrough** — Forward full tool parameter
schemas via `parametersJsonSchema` instead of the lossy `parameters`
form; corrected tool response role to `user`; resolved structured output
+ tools conflict (#3761)
- **Anthropic Stop Reason & Tool Versions** — Normalized stop reason
mapping (`end_turn` to `stop`, `tool_use` to `tool_calls`, `max_tokens`
to `length`) and upgraded `text_editor_20250124`/`str_replace_editor` to
`text_editor_20250728` for computer-use tools (#3761)
- **Azure Endpoint Redaction** — Fixed a panic when
`AzureKeyConfig.Endpoint` is a literal value rather than an env
reference (#3761)
- **Auth Middleware Path Match** — Match temp-token auth middleware
whitelist against the request path only, not the full URI with query
parameters (#3737)
- **Governance Blocked Models UI** — Restored the missing Blocked Models
create/edit UI in the VK provider config sheet (#3750)
- **Logging Plugin Cleanup Drain** — Fixed a shutdown race where
`batchWriter` could drop in-flight log entries; `Cleanup` now drains
both the recovered batch and remaining queue within a 30-second budget
(#3717)
- **Model Rankings Empty Entries** — Excluded entries with empty `model`
values from model rankings matview queries so blank rows no longer
surface in the UI (#3758)
- **User Filter Duplicates** — Recreated `mv_filter_users` matview to
require non-empty `user_name`, eliminating duplicate filter dropdown
entries (#3764)
- **User Filter Display Name** — Use `user_name` instead of `user_id` as
the display label for users in logging filters (#3691)
- **Large Numeric ID Precision** — Preserve large numeric IDs in URL
search params by skipping JSON parsing for plain strings (#3692)
